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ration
Don’t wait until it’s too late – catch these warning signs early to prevent costly repairs and ensure a safe and healthy home. Our team has seen it all, and we’re here to help you identify the signs of water damage before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your condo that won’t go away, it could be a sign of water damage. Mold and mildew thrive in damp environments, and can cause serious health problems if left unchecked.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ains on walls or ceilings are a clear indication of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can show a larger issue that needs to be addressed.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, and can also show a larger issue with your home’s foundation.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age, and can also show a larger issue with your home’s structural integrity.
Increased Humidity
Increased humidity in your condo can be a sign of water damage, and can also show a larger issue with your home’s ventilation system.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age, such as water spots or mineral deposits, can be a clear indication of water damage.

Common Questions About Condo Water Damage Restoration
What is the average cost of condo water damage restoration in Englewood, OH?
The average cost of condo water damage restoration in Englewood, OH can range from $500 to $10,000, dep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. It’s best to schedule a free estimate to get a more accurate quote.
How long does it take to restore a condo after water damage?
The length of time it takes to restore a condo after water damage depends on the extent of the damage and the complexity of the repair. In some cases, it can take as little as 3-5 days, while in more complex cases, it may take up to 2 weeks or more.
Is water damage covered by insurance?
Yes, water damage is typically covered by insurance, but the extent of coverage depends on the type of policy and the circumstances of the damage. It’s best to check with your insurance provider to find out the specifics of your coverage.
Can I prevent water damage in my condo?
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ent water damage in your condo, including checking your plumbing regularly, fixing leaks quickly, and keeping an eye out for signs of water damage. Regular maintenance can go a long way in preventing costly repairs.
What are the risks of not addressing water damage quickly?
The risks of not addressing water damage quickly include further damage to your condo, health problems from mold and mildew growth, and decreased property value. It’s essential to address water damage quickly to prevent these risks.
